Output 66a583c5a48013e32465b425678aa9d1c86fd112bca2fe6ec817076c42a78823:1

value
3096752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9278d8ee25c43d0b777da95e0c2dfd2a70cdee20 OP_EQUAL
address
3F3VMB52VXE38ktQK9cqmta1sMDTEJJzEq
transaction
66a583c5a48013e32465b425678aa9d1c86fd112bca2fe6ec817076c42a78823
spent
true